News Feature
Rufus Candage of Blue Hill has been named Maine Boxing Commissioner. This job will entail the policing and promoting of all boxing activities in the state. A native of Blue Hill, Candage applied for the job, was nominated by Governor Reed, and was later approved by the Governor’s Council. He has always been interested in sports. He has done promotional work in semi-pro basketball and semi-pro baseball in both Waldo and Hancock counties, and hopes to expand this program to include all of eastern Maine in 1961. Candage also heads the Blue Hill Fair baseball program, and was instrumental in getting Junior League teams started in Blue Hill.
